Episode: This hockey player-turned-designer crafted something very Canadian
Description: Last month, Rogers asked Canadians everywhere to donate their old hockey jerseys for a unique display of national pride and unity. They wanted a wide variety of colours and logos from coast to coast — from Timbits to beer leagues and everything in between.Cameron Lizotte took over from there.A former OHL hockey player who traded his skates for fashion design, the Sudbury native was handpicked to slice up the donations and transform them into five one-of-a-kind jerseys.
